Estonia Urges ‘No Fiscal Limits’ on European Support for Ukraine

Estonia Urges ‘No Fiscal Limits’ on European Support for Ukraine

13 Ocak 2026Bloomberg

🤖AI Özeti

Estonia's finance minister has urged European governments to provide unlimited financial support for Ukraine, emphasizing the need for solidarity despite the budgetary constraints some nations are experiencing. This call comes as Ukraine continues to face significant challenges amid ongoing conflict. Estonia's stance highlights the urgency of international assistance to ensure Ukraine's resilience and stability.
